Administration and Finance Office Job at Abt Associates in Uganda

Job Title:       Administrative Assistant / Administration and Finance Office

Organisation: Abt Associates

Project Name: USAID/Uganda’s Integrated Community, Agriculture, and Nutrition (ICAN) Activity

Duty Station: Kampala, Uganda

Reports to: Finance, Compliance and Administration Director

About Abt:

Abt Associates is an international development organization composed of dedicated professionals who provide technical assistance, research, analysis, and practical training services in more than 128 countries. Abt seeks to implement a five-year project funded by the U.S Agency for International Development (USAID).

About USAID ICAN Project:

Abt Associates is implementing the USAID/Uganda’s Integrated Community, Agriculture, and Nutrition (ICAN) Activity, which will aim to sustainably enhance the resilience of vulnerable households by increasing economic opportunities for poor households, improving nutrition with a focus on women and children, and strengthening community and local governance.

Job Summary:  The Administrative Assistant / Administration and Finance Office is responsible for providing administrative, logistical, and financial support to the office.

Key Duties and Responsibilities: 

  • Liaises closely with technical teams to anticipate needs for project events and staff travel. Makes all ICAN travel arranges
  • Defines specifications, identifies prospective suppliers, and gathers competitive price quotations for goods and services required by ICAN
  • Maintains an accurate inventory of expendable and non-expendable property
  • Maintains a system for filling project documents, invoices, and other supporting documentation
  • Other duties as required

Qualifications, Skills and Experience:

  • The ideal candidate for the USAID Project Administrative Assistant / Administration and Finance Office job placement should hold a Bachelor’s Degree in management, finance, accounting, or a related field
  • Two years of professional experience
  • Experience with procurement and/or finance
  • Experience working with USAID-funded programs highly preferred
  • Demonstrated ability to work both as a member of a team and as a team leader, with the ability to accept the inputs of other team members
  • Excellent interpersonal communication, organizational, and computer skills
  • English language fluency
